F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

1,592 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Ford (F)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$26.7B — up 11% from $24B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 143 funds opened new F positions and 134 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 665 added to existing stakes and 581 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Squarepoint, adding an estimated $257M. The largest seller was Arrowstreet Capital, cutting an estimated $142M.
